Hoya Field Hockey Blanks St. Francis, 3-0

Sept. 1, 2006

Box Score

Washington, D.C. - The Georgetown field hockey team won their first game of the season with a 3-0 shutout over St. Francis today in Loretto, Pa. Two goals from sophomore forward Katie Lachman (Bryn Mawr, Pa./Radnor) would ensure the Hoya victory.

The Hoyas out-shot the Red Flash (0-2), 8-4 overall, with the GU defense holding St. Francis to just one shot taken in the first half. With the minutes closing down to halftime, Lachman took a pass from freshman midfielder Willemijn Wijsman (Hilversum, The Netherlands/International School Hilversum) and scored the first goal of the game, her first of the season.

In the second half, Wijsman scored her first goal as a Hoya to put the Blue and Gray up, 2-0; the assist went to sophomore forward Maggie Farrand (Baltimore, Md./Bryn Mawr). Just minutes shy of the end of regulation, Lachman scored the final goal for Georgetown, unassisted, from five yards out.

Senior goalkeeper Abby Winer (Rising Sun, Md./Rising Sun) recorded her first win of the season with the shutout, holding off three SFU attempts.

Georgetown (1-1) returns to action on Saturday, September 9 when they host Lehigh on Kehoe Field at 1 p.m. It will be the first of a three-game home stint for the squad as they host Robert Morris on Sunday, September 10 and Towson on Wednesday, September 13.
